A BIOCHEMICAL ANALYSIS OF THE REACTION OF MUSCLE TISSUE TO RADIATION DAMAGE UNDER CONDITIONS OF MECHANICAL TRAUMA (in Russian)
One of the hind extremities of the white rat was subjected to an x-ray dose of 2000 r with a 5 mm lead protective shield being used to cover the rest of the body. On the day after irradiation, a transverse cut was made in th calf muscle, or else a graft of granulated irradiated calf muscle was performed. No operation was carried out on the control group. The rats were killed on the lst, 2nd, and 3rd days after the operation. The use of transplanted, granulated tissue hastened the recovery process. The content of ribonucleic acid (RNA) was 260% above normal. The RNA content was found to attain 200% above normal for the rats with a transverse cut on the caif. lf the transverse cut is made after irradiation, the recuperative process is slowed down significantly. The recuperative processes begin earlier and proceed more intensively with the use of transplanted, granulated muscle tissue than they do when a transverse cut is made on the calf muscle. (TTT)
